rcMstpPortRxTcnBpduCounter

Module: SWITCH-MSTP-MIB

OID (symbolic): SWITCH-MSTP-MIB::rcMstpPortRxTcnBpduCounter

OID (numeric): 1.3.6.1.4.1.8886.6.1.24.3.1.8

Node type: OBJECT-TYPE

Type: Counter32

Access: read-only

Description: Received Topology Change Notification (TCN) Messages.

What is rcMstpPortRxTcnBpduCounter?

Count of Topology Change Notification (TCN) BPDUs this port has received, a rising counter that flags a segment generating frequent topology-change events.

Examples

Walk all instances (SNMPv2c):

snmpwalk -v2c -c public <target> 1.3.6.1.4.1.8886.6.1.24.3.1.8
snmpwalk -v2c -c public <target> SWITCH-MSTP-MIB::rcMstpPortRxTcnBpduCounter

Get a specific instance (index 1):

snmpget -v2c -c public <target> 1.3.6.1.4.1.8886.6.1.24.3.1.8.1
snmpget -v2c -c public <target> SWITCH-MSTP-MIB::rcMstpPortRxTcnBpduCounter.1

SNMPv3 example:

snmpget -v3 -l authPriv -u snmpv3-user -a SHA -A "AuthPassword1" -x AES -X "PrivPassword1" <target> rcMstpPortRxTcnBpduCounter.1
